在当今的互联网时代,表单作为用户与网站之间交互的重要桥梁,其设计和开发质量直接影响到用户体验和业务流程的效率。选择合适的Web表单开发框架对于快速搭建高效、美观且功能丰富的表单至关重要。本文将深度测评并推荐三大流行的Web表单开发框架:Bootstrap、jQuery EasyUI和Ant Design。
一、Bootstrap
Bootstrap 是一个开源的、基于 HTML、CSS 和 JavaScript 的前端框架,由 Twitter 的设计师和开发者共同开发。它提供了丰富的组件和工具,可以帮助开发者快速搭建响应式布局的网页。
1. 优点
- 响应式设计:Bootstrap 提供了响应式网格系统,可以轻松实现不同设备上的适配。
- 组件丰富:包括按钮、表单、导航栏等丰富的 UI 组件,满足多种设计需求。
- 易于上手:文档齐全,社区活跃,学习曲线平缓。
2. 缺点
- 性能:由于组件丰富,页面加载速度可能会受到影响。
- 定制性:默认样式较为固定,定制化需要一定的 CSS 编写能力。
3. 适用场景
适合快速搭建响应式表单,尤其适合对性能要求不高的项目。
二、jQuery EasyUI
jQuery EasyUI 是一个基于 jQuery 的 UI 库,它提供了丰富的 UI 组件和交互效果,可以快速构建富客户端的网页应用。
1. 优点
- 组件丰富:包括表格、表单、对话框、树形菜单等组件,满足多种需求。
- 易于集成:与 jQuery 集成度高,学习成本较低。
- 性能优越:轻量级,加载速度快。
2. 缺点
- 更新频率:更新频率相对较低,可能存在一些过时的功能。
- 文档支持:虽然文档齐全,但部分功能描述不够详细。
3. 适用场景
适合构建功能复杂、交互丰富的表单,尤其适合对性能要求较高的项目。
三、Ant Design
Ant Design 是一个基于 React 的 UI 设计语言和库,它提供了丰富的组件和设计资源,旨在帮助开发者快速构建高质量的 React 应用。
1. 优点
- 组件丰富:包括表单、表格、布局等组件,满足多种设计需求。
- 设计规范:遵循 Ant Design 设计规范,保证设计一致性。
- 社区支持:社区活跃,文档齐全,学习资源丰富。
2. 缺点
- 学习成本:相对于 Bootstrap 和 jQuery EasyUI,学习成本较高。
- 性能:由于 React 的虚拟 DOM,页面渲染速度可能会受到影响。
3. 适用场景
适合构建高性能、高质量的 React 应用,尤其适合对设计要求较高的项目。
四、总结
选择合适的 Web 表单开发框架需要根据项目需求、团队技能和性能要求等因素综合考虑。Bootstrap 适合快速搭建响应式表单,jQuery EasyUI 适合构建功能复杂、交互丰富的表单,Ant Design 适合构建高性能、高质量的 React 应用。希望本文的测评和推荐能帮助您找到最适合您项目的 Web 表单开发框架。
